Messages : 11 à 20
Page 2 sur 3
Total des messages : 29
le xx/xx/202x à xx:xx
Visiteur 20
Tout visiteur peut également insérer directement via un copié/collé des
émoticones trouvés partout sur le Web.
Par exemple, regardez ce que cela donne :
🐐 🦌 🦙 🦥 🦘 🐘 🦣 🦏 🦛 🦒 🐒 🦍 🦧 🐪
le xx/xx/202x à xx:xx
Visiteur 19
🙋
Ce Livre d'Or est livré avec 10 pages suppmémentaires.
Comment obtenir d'autres pages ?
Suffit tout bêtement d'effectuer un copié/collé d'une de ces pages, ensuite :
1 ▪️ de l'éditer de préférence avec Notepad+
2 ▪️ de supprimer seulement les messages en zone clairement définie
3 ▪️ de renommer cette page avec seulement la modification de son numéro
4 ▪️ de l'uploader à l'aide de par exemple FileZilla afin de la placer sur le serveur
5 ▪️ d'éditer le fichier "inc_var.php" afin
6 ▪️ de simplement modifier le contenu de la variable "$nbr_pages"
7 ▪️ si par exemple vous avez ajouté une onzième page, hé bien cette ligne devra être :
8 ▪️ $nbr_pages = 11;
9 ▪️ le "11" corrrespond logiquement à vos onze pages. la pagination sera automatique
(attention : n'oubliez pas le point virgule terminant cette ligne !!!)
10 ▪️ suffit ensuite d'enregistrer ce fichier "inc_var.php"
11 ▪️ et vous bénéficierez automatiquement d'une page supplémentaire
12 ▪️ voyez d'ailleurs ci-dessous la structure du fichier "inc_var.php" :
le xx/xx/202x à xx:xx
Visiteur 18
// VARIABLES DE FONCTIONNEMENT POUR BASIKALEX GUESTBOOK
// Nom racine des pages de messages
// (SAUF la première qui sera toujours celle des messages récents : index.php par défaut)
// lopm = 'L' pour Livre, 'O' pour Or, 'P' pour Page et 'M' pour Messages
$url_base = 'lopm';
// Nombre total de messages sur le Livre
$nbr_total_msg = 29;
// Nombre de pages, Y COMPRIS la page "index.php" des messages récents
$nbr_pages = 3;
// Nombre de messages par page
$nbr_msg_page = 10;
// Nom page des messages récents (SANS EXTENSION)
$nom_page_msg_rec = 'index';
le xx/xx/202x à xx:xx
Visiteur 17
Ce fichier nommé "inc_var.php" est le cœur du Livre d'Or et permet
de définir cinq commandes importantes :
▪️ $url_base = 'lopm'; (variable PHP permettant de (re)nommer les pages)
▪️ $nbr_total_msg = 29; (variable PHP permettant d'affecter le nombre de messages)
▪️ $nbr_pages = 3; (variable PHP permettant d'affecter le nombre de pages : ici 3)
A cet effet, testez vous-même en affectant 7 pages... Et regardez le résultat
la pagination comme par magie est automatiquement adaptée à ce nombre de pages
▪️ $nbr_msg_page = 10; (nombre de messages par page : ici 10 par défaut)
▪️ $nom_page_msg_rec = 'index'; (nom de la page d'accueil du Livre d'Or )
le xx/xx/202x à xx:xx
Visiteur 16
Que dire de plus ?
Faudra lire et accepter les termes de la licence 📜 de Basikalex Guestbook permettant
à votre site de s'enrichir de ce magnifique Livre d'Or 🌞 offert à vos visiteurs.
Par contre cet avantage est lié à des obligations, dont l'une est de laisser bien clairement en vue les
indications de copyright :
en haut de pages, le logo de ce Livre d'Or et au bas les deux lignes indicatrices.
Peu importe la présentation, la couleur ; le principal est que ce soit clairement visible.
Si vous n'êtes pas d'accord, de facto vous n'êtes pas autorisé à bénéficier de ce Livre d'Or.
le xx/xx/202x à xx:xx
Visiteur 15
Oupsss, si si, toujours des éléments à ajouter.
Comment insérer un nouveau message ?
Lorsqu'un visiteur aura validé son message, vous recevrez un message.
Ce message contiendra une zone définie qu'il vous suffira de la copier/coller
dans la page des messages récents nommée "index.php" (ou autre si renommage).
Une zone clairement balisée est présente à cet effet : placez à chaque fois
le message le plus récent en haut.
le xx/xx/202x à xx:xx
Visiteur 14
Lorsque cette page "index.php" contiendra bien plus de messages que vous avez paramétré (par défaut 10),
il sera temps de copier/coller les 10 messages du bas dans la nouvelle page.
Sans soublier d'ensuite incrémenter (= ajouter de 1) le nombre de pages en fichier "inc_var.php".
(L'automatisation PHP seul à ce niveau n'est malheureusement pas possible)
le xx/xx/202x à xx:xx
Visiteur 13
Par précaution au moment de "transférer" les messages sur la nouvelle page,
il est fortement conseillé d'auparavant réaliser un copié/collé de la page
index.php.
De cette façon, si ça rate ou perdez le contenu de votre presse-papier, hé bien
vous conserverez toujours ces précieux messages.
le xx/xx/202x à xx:xx
Visiteur 12
Bien entendu toutes ces manipulations pouraient fort bien être automatisées
via une Base de Données...
Mais la loi des avantages et inconvénients rapplique illico...
Le principe de Basikalex Guestbook a été volontairement conçut dans le but
d'une simplicité, robustesse et fiabilité optimale.
✔️ Aucune faille possible d'injection SQL (ou SQLi) ; puisque ne possédant aucune BdD.
✔️ Aucune mise à jour critique de Base de Données n'est à prévoir.
✔️ Aucune perte de messages car tout est déjà inscrit "en dur" sur vos pages.
le xx/xx/202x à xx:xx
Visiteur 11
Puisque la démonstration de ce Livre d'Or, en fichier "inc_var.php",
est paramétrée sur
3 pages : si vous cliquez sur
l'hyperlien "suivante >>" juste ci-dessous à droite...